Built for Every Season: How Commercial Spaces Adapt for Fall and Winter

As summer gives way to fall, commercial outdoor spaces face a familiar challenge: what happens when the weather stops cooperating?

For restaurants, hotels, bars and other hospitality businesses, patios and rooftops can represent some of the most desirable and valuable areas of a property. During the warmer months, these spaces attract guests looking for fresh air, views and an open-air atmosphere. But falling temperatures, wind, rain and eventually snow can quickly change how those spaces can be used. Commercial spaces designed with adaptability in mind don’t have to make the same seasonal transition.

Retractable enclosures allow businesses to respond to changing weather while preserving the experience that makes an outdoor space appealing in the first place. As fall and winter approach, properties with these systems already in place are prepared to make the most of their spaces throughout the colder months.

Extending the Life of Valuable Commercial Space

Outdoor square footage can be a significant asset for a commercial property, particularly in the hospitality industry. A restaurant patio can add dining capacity. A hotel rooftop can become a destination for guests and locals. An outdoor event space can create additional opportunities for private gatherings.

The challenge is that without weather protection, the value of that space is closely tied to the forecast.

A retractable enclosure changes that equation by giving operators greater control over when and how the space can be used. Instead of simply closing an outdoor area once patio season ends, businesses can adapt the space as conditions change.

Fall Weather Calls for Flexibility

Fall is one of the best examples of why flexibility matters.

A warm, sunny afternoon may be perfect for an open-air experience, while temperatures can drop significantly after sunset. Rain and wind can arrive unexpectedly, and conditions can change considerably from one day to the next.

A retractable roof or enclosure allows a commercial space to respond accordingly. When the weather is beautiful, the system can open and preserve the outdoor atmosphere. When conditions change, it can close to provide protection from the elements.

Rather than choosing permanently between an indoor or outdoor environment, businesses can have elements of both.

Preparing for the Colder Months

That flexibility becomes even more valuable as fall transitions into winter.

Restaurants and hospitality properties with outdoor areas traditionally face a seasonal limitation: highly desirable spaces can become difficult or impossible to use once colder weather arrives.

Weather-protected spaces provide an alternative. An enclosed patio or rooftop provides continued use of the coveted outdoor space.

For businesses that already have retractable enclosures installed, this means the arrival of colder weather doesn’t signal the end of rooftop or patio season.

More Predictability for Businesses and Guests

Weather affects more than guest comfort. It can also create operational uncertainty.

An unexpected storm or temperature drop can affect reservations, seating capacity, events and staffing. For restaurants and event-driven hospitality businesses, losing an outdoor area can mean losing a significant portion of usable space for the day.

Creating a space that can quickly adapt to weather conditions gives operators another layer of predictability. It also allows guests to enjoy the atmosphere of a rooftop, patio or terrace without the experience depending entirely on perfect weather.

Designing Commercial Spaces for More Than One Season

The most effective commercial outdoor spaces aren’t necessarily designed for one particular type of weather. They’re designed to change with it.

That’s the idea behind retractable architecture. Instead of permanently enclosing an outdoor space or leaving it completely exposed, a retractable system allows the environment to change throughout the day and throughout the year.

And as fall arrives, commercial properties that planned for that flexibility are entering the season with an important advantage.
